[quote=DAISY ,2676]Hi, Sasha!According what you mentioned above, I think you should get a Visit / Business Visa (F) or Working Visa (Z).Visa F is issued to those foreigners who are invited to China for visit, research, lecture, business, scientific-technological and cultural exchanges or short-term advanced studies or intern practice for a period of less than six months. The invitation letter from the inviting unit or a visa notification letter/telegram from the authorised unit is required.While Visa Z is issued to foreigners who are to take up a post or employment in China, and their accompanying family members.An Employment Licence from either your proposed employer in China or from the provincial or municipal labor authority is required to be obtained. A visa notification letter or a telegram issued by an authorised organization or company as appropriate should accompany this document.I think the invitation letter and the Licence cab be offered by the school that you will work for in Guangzhou.
